# Fun Language Specification v0.3
|
||||
|
||||
This document describes Fun (Fun Uses Nothing) as of version 0.3. It supersedes v0.2 by formalizing classes/objects, inheritance, namespaced includes, richer collections and builtins, concurrency primitives, networking and OS integration, as reflected by the examples.
|
||||
|
||||
---
|
||||
|
||||
## 1) Overview and Goals
|
||||
|
||||
- Readable: strict, indentation-based syntax (2 spaces), no semicolons.
|
||||
- Safe: explicit types, no implicit numeric coercions, bounds-checked operations, controlled side effects.
|
||||
- Hackable: pragmatic stdlib, process I/O, sockets, threads.
|
||||
|
||||
What’s new in v0.3 (high level):
|
||||
- Classes and objects with methods, constructors, and inheritance (`extends`).
|
||||
- Dot-call sugar for method calls, and explicit `this` in method definitions.
|
||||
- Namespaced `#include ... as alias` for module imports.
|
||||
- Maps (dictionaries) with literals and helpers.
|
||||
- Control-flow additions: `break` and `continue`.
|
||||
- Threads: `thread_spawn`, `thread_join` and `sleep`.
|
||||
- Expanded system and network APIs (TCP/Unix sockets, serial, env, timers).
|
||||
- Bitwise helpers (`band`, `bor`, `bxor`, `bnot`, `shl`).
|
||||
- Exception syntax (`try/catch/finally`) is defined; runtime throwing/handling may be partial.
|
||||
|

## 2) Lexical Structure
|
||||
|
||||
- Case-sensitive identifiers: letters, digits, `_`; must not start with a digit.
|
||||
- Comments:
|
||||
- Single-line: `// comment`
|
||||
- Multi-line: `/* ... */`
|
||||
- Whitespace and newlines:
|
||||
- Indentation is exactly 2 spaces; tabs are forbidden.
|
||||
- Newline terminates statements; no semicolons.
|
||||
|
||||
Reserved keywords (cannot be redefined):
|
||||
- `if`, `else`, `for`, `while`, `break`, `continue`
|
||||
- `fun`, `return`
|
||||
- `class`, `extends`
|
||||
- `global`, `private`
|
||||
- `true`, `false`
|
||||
- `try`, `catch`, `finally`
|
||||
|
||||
Notes:
|
||||
- `#include` is a directive, not an expression; `as` is part of the include alias syntax (see Modules & Includes).
|
||||
|
||||
---
|
||||
|
||||
## 3) Types
|
||||
|
||||
Scalar types:
|
||||
- `number`: 64-bit signed integer.
|
||||
- `float`: 64-bit IEEE-754 floating point.
|
||||
- `string`
|
||||
- `boolean`: `true` / `false` (in conditionals `0` and `1` are accepted where noted).
|
||||
- `byte`: 8-bit value (see conversions and overflow rules).
|
||||
|
||||
Fixed-width integers (signed/unsigned):
|
||||
- `int8`, `uint8`, `int16`, `uint16`, `int32`, `uint32`, `int64`, `uint64`
|
||||
|
||||
Aggregate types:
|
||||
- `array` and typed arrays: `array<T>`
|
||||
- `map<K, V>` (dictionary / associative array)
|
||||
- `object` (instances of `class`)
|
||||
|
||||
Examples:
|
||||
```fun
|
||||
number n = 42
|
||||
float pi = 3.14159
|
||||
string s = 'He said: "Fun!"'
|
||||
boolean ok = true
|
||||
byte b = 0x41
|
||||
|
||||
array<number> nums = [1, 2, 3]
|
||||
array mixed = [1, "two", true, [3, 4]]
|
||||
|
||||
m = { "a": 1, "b": 2 } // map<string, number>
|
||||
```
|
||||
|
||||
Dynamic typing escape hatch (discouraged; use when interacting with unknown data):
|
||||
```fun
|
||||
dynamic string x = 42 // allowed by spec; runtime performs dynamic checks
|
||||
x = "Now I'm a string"
|
||||
```
|
||||
|
||||
---
|
||||
|
||||
## 4) Variables and Scope
|
||||
|
||||
- `global` variables are visible program-wide.
|
||||
- `private` variables are file-local (module private).
|
||||
- Rebinding a global or shadowing a name is a compile-time error.
|
||||
|
||||
```fun
|
||||
global string message = "Hello"
|
||||
private number count = 42
|
||||
number local = 23
|
||||
```
|
||||
|
||||
---
|
||||
|
||||
## 5) Operators and Builtins
|
||||
|
||||
Arithmetic: `+`, `-`, `*`, `/`, `%`
|
||||
|
||||
Comparison: `==`, `!=`, `>`, `<`, `>=`, `<=`
|
||||
|
||||
Boolean: `&&`, `||`, `!`
|
||||
|
||||
Assignment: `=`
|
||||
|
||||
Bitwise helpers (functions):
|
||||
- `band(a, b)`, `bor(a, b)`, `bxor(a, b)`, `bnot(a)`, `shl(a, n)`
|
||||
|
||||
```fun
|
||||
print(bxor(0x80000000, 0x00000001)) // 2147483649
|
||||
print(shl(0x80, 24)) // 2147483648
|
||||
```
|
||||
|
||||
Collection helpers (selected):
|
||||
- Arrays: `push(arr, v)`, `join(arr, sep)`, `map(arr, f)`, `filter(arr, pred)`, `reduce(arr, init, f)`
|
||||
- Maps: `has(m, key)`, `keys(m)`, `values(m)`
|
||||
|
||||
Type/convert helpers (selected):
|
||||
- `typeof(x) -> string`
|
||||
- `to_string(x)` and numeric casts (see examples for `cast_demo.fun` and `conversions_showcase.fun`)
|
||||
|
||||
---

## 8) Classes and Objects
|
||||
|
||||
Definition:
|
||||
```fun
|
||||
class Name(/* optional ctor params with types */)
|
||||
// field defaults
|
||||
field1 = 0
|
||||
field2 = ""
|
||||
|
||||
// method: first parameter must be `this`
|
||||
fun method(this, arg1, arg2)
|
||||
// ...
|
||||
return 0
|
||||
```
|
||||
|
||||
Constructors:
|
||||
- Default constructor maps the class header parameters to fields of the same names.
|
||||
- Optional explicit constructor hook: define `fun _construct(this, ...params...)` to customize initialization. It is invoked automatically on instantiation.
|
||||
|
||||
Fields and methods:
|
||||
- Fields are created/initialized with simple assignments in the class body.
|
||||
- Methods are functions declared inside the class; the first parameter must be `this`.
|
||||
- Private members: any field or method whose name starts with `_` is considered private to the class. Accessing them from outside should raise an access error.
|
||||
|
||||
Instantiation and method calls:
|
||||
```fun
|
||||
p = Point(10, -2)
|
||||
print(p.x) // field access via `.` or indexing
|
||||
print(p["x"]) // map-like field access is supported
|
||||
|
||||
// Dot-call sugar: p.method(a, b) is equivalent to method(p, a, b)
|
||||
print(p.toString())
|
||||
```
|
||||
|
||||
Method references:
|
||||
```fun
|
||||
move_fn = p["move"]
|
||||
move_fn(p, 3, 5) // call with explicit `this`
|
||||
```
|
||||
|
||||
Inheritance:
|
||||
```fun
|
||||
class Parent(number start)
|
||||
value = 0
|
||||
fun _construct(this, s)
|
||||
this.value = s
|
||||
|
||||
fun describe(this)
|
||||
return "Parent(value=" + to_string(this.value) + ")"
|
||||
|
||||
class Child(number start) extends Parent
|
||||
bonus = 5
|
||||
fun _construct(this, s)
|
||||
// runs after parent fields merged
|
||||
this.value = this.value + this.bonus
|
||||
fun describe(this)
|
||||
return "Child(value=" + to_string(this.value) + ", bonus=" + to_string(this.bonus) + ")"
|
||||
```
|
||||
|
||||
`typeof` on classes and instances:
|
||||
- `typeof(Point) == "Class"`
|
||||
- `typeof(p) == "Point(10, -2)"` (implementation-specific descriptive form)
|
||||
|
||||

## 9) Modules and Includes
|
||||
|
||||
Include sources:
|
||||
- System/stdlib: angle brackets search the Fun library path (e.g., `FUN_LIB_DIR`).
|
||||
```fun
|
||||
#include <utils/math.fun>
|
||||
```
|
||||
- Local file: quoted, relative to the current working directory or file.
|
||||
```fun
|
||||
#include "./utils/file.fun"
|
||||
```
|
||||
- Absolute path is supported.
|
||||
|
||||
Namespaced includes:
|
||||
- Use `as` to bind a module into a namespace alias.
|
||||
```fun
|
||||
#include <utils/math.fun> as m
|
||||
#include "examples/namespaced_mod.fun" as mod
|
||||
|
||||
print(m.add(2, 3))
|
||||
g = mod.Greeter("Hi")
|
||||
g.say("World")
|
||||
```
|
||||
|
||||
Aliased access uses `alias.symbol` or `alias.ClassName`.
|
||||
|
||||
Global/private at file scope control symbol exports from a module.
|
||||
|
||||
---
|
||||
|
||||
## 10) Collections
|
||||
|
||||
Arrays:
|
||||
- Literals with `[ ... ]`; may be heterogeneous unless `array<T>` is declared.
|
||||
- Helpers: `push`, `join`, `map`, `filter`, `reduce`, iteration via `for x in arr`.
|
||||
|
||||
Maps:
|
||||
- Literal: `{ key: value, ... }`
|
||||
- Indexing: `m["a"]`, assignment `m["c"] = 5`
|
||||
- Introspection: `has(m, key)`, `keys(m)`, `values(m)`
|
||||
- Iterate keys/values using arrays returned by `keys`/`values`.
|
||||
|
||||
---
|
||||
|
||||
## 11) Concurrency (Threads)
|
||||
|
||||
- `thread_spawn(fn, args)` starts `fn` in a new thread. `args` may be a single value or an array for multiple arguments.
|
||||
- `thread_join(id)` waits for the thread and returns its result.
|
||||
- `sleep(ms)` suspends current thread.
|
||||
|
||||
Example:
|
||||
```fun
|
||||
fun square(n)
|
||||
sleep(100)
|
||||
return n * n
|
||||
|
||||
ids = []
|
||||
for x in [1, 2, 3]
|
||||
push(ids, thread_spawn(square, x))
|
||||
|
||||
results = []
|
||||
for id in ids
|
||||
push(results, thread_join(id))
|
||||
|
||||
print(results)
|
||||
```
|
||||
|
